So let's go to the fun part. Cupcakes!

So basically this cupcake was inspired by s'mores. It has a graham cracker and chopped chocolate base. You bake that for about 5 minutes just to get that crunch we all love. Then you add the chocolate batter, it's very easy to do, very thin batter too! Then you add a little bit of graham cracker mix and chocolate on top to give an extra chocolatey and crunchy top. To finish it off, we have a meringue frosting, it tastes a lot like marshmallow, and unlike the normal meringue (French meringue?), you actually put the white egg plus sugar mixture on a double boiler while you let the two things incorporate, and make sure the sugar is completely melted or else you will have lots of crystals on your frosting and that is not ideal at all okay lol. I think this is called Swiss meringue. We're supposed to torch the marshmallow frosting because it's supposed to be a s'mores cupcake, but I don't have a blowtorch. What I did was I put the frosted cupcakes back to the oven and just let it bake for another five minutes, just to make that frosting burn a little so it would be crunchy.
